idea解決Git分支合并沖突問題
idea解決Git分支合并沖突
最近使用gitlab在網(wǎng)頁上合并分支,遇到了沖突,我希望都保留,但是在網(wǎng)頁上只能選擇保留一份,我是使用idea解決了沖突保存了兩份。
步驟如下
- 前提條件:分支有沖突,如下。
- 分支名稱:分支11111111,bbb.txt內(nèi)容
分支名稱:conflict-test
可以看到,當(dāng)前兩個(gè)分支同一個(gè)文件里面的內(nèi)容是不一樣的。
1.切換到目標(biāo)分支,更新到最新代碼版本
目標(biāo)分支:分支1111111,idea切換到這個(gè)分支上,如圖:
2.把要合并的源分支代碼拉到目標(biāo)分支上
將源分支(conflict-test)pull到當(dāng)前分支(分支1111111)來
如圖,勾選conflict-test,再點(diǎn)擊pull
3.使用idea解決分支的沖突
上一步點(diǎn)擊了pull之后,會提示有代碼沖突,點(diǎn)擊Merge,合并代碼,解決沖突。
點(diǎn)擊Merge,合并之后代碼如下:
4.提交代碼到目標(biāo)分支上
然后commit,再push到分支1111111,就可以了(有些會自動commit,直接push就行)
總結(jié)
以上為個(gè)人經(jīng)驗(yàn),希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
相關(guān)文章
Java?9中List.of()的使用示例及注意事項(xiàng)
Java 9引入了一個(gè)新的靜態(tài)工廠方法List.of(),用于創(chuàng)建不可變的列表對象,這篇文章主要介紹了Java?9中List.of()的使用示例及注意事項(xiàng)的相關(guān)資料,文中通過代碼介紹的非常詳細(xì),需要的朋友可以參考下2025-03-03Hibernate環(huán)境搭建與配置方法(Hello world配置文件版)
這篇文章主要介紹了Hibernate環(huán)境搭建與配置方法,這里演示Hello world配置文件版的具體實(shí)現(xiàn)步驟與相關(guān)代碼,需要的朋友可以參考下2016-03-03Java Collection集合遍歷運(yùn)行代碼實(shí)例
這篇文章主要介紹了Java Collection集合遍歷運(yùn)行代碼實(shí)例,文中通過示例代碼介紹的非常詳細(xì),對大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友可以參考下2020-04-04